Analysis
In 2020, broad money in Lesotho stood at 14.28 billion Domestic currency. That is the highest value across all 20 years on record.
The figure is up 17.1% on the previous year and up 121.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, broad money in Lesotho peaked at 14.28 billion Domestic currency in 2020 and was at its lowest, 1.99 billion Domestic currency, in 2001.
That places Lesotho 128th out of 144 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
